The first impression
Passion by Bahoma London is a Chypre Floral fragrance for women. Passion was launched in 2016. The nose behind this fragrance is Margaret Strug-Guzowska. Top notes are Fruity Notes, Pineapple, Cardamom, Anise and Lemon; middle notes are Gardenia, Jasmine, Patchouli, Lily and Cyclamen; base notes are Amber, Cedar, Galbanum, Musk and Labdanum.

The perfumer behind it
Margaret Strug-Guzowska
Margaret Strug-Guzowska is a perfumer known for her work with Bahoma London. Her catalog includes fragrances like Chameleon, Desire, and Lavender Veil. She creates scents that range from fresh and aquatic to warm and indulgent. Her style often emphasizes clarity and balance.
